Product Description of Sodium dithionite CAS#7775-14-6

Sodium dithionite, also known as sodium hydrosulfite, sodium hydrosulphite, sodium sulfoxylate, or sulfoxylate, is a strong reducing agent. It is unstable under physiological conditions, with decomposition accelerating in acidic environments. When exposed to moisture, it is oxidized to hydrogen sulfite, sulfite, and hydrogen sulfate, and under strongly acidic conditions may release sulfur dioxide. In anaerobic environments, hydrogen sulfite and thiosulfate can form. After ingestion, hydrogen sulfite may be absorbed, rapidly metabolized, and mainly excreted as sulfate in urine.

Owing to its strong reducing ability and high reactivity with oxygen, sodium dithionite is widely used across various industries. Its applications include textile dyeing, pulp and paper bleaching to remove yellowing from cellulose-based materials, oxygen scavenging in boilers, conservation for removing iron stains from cultural artifacts, and water treatment to control iron-related discoloration during bleaching. It is also used in photographic processing, clay and ceramic production, wine making, leather processing, food and beverage industries, polymer manufacturing, cleaning formulations, gas purification, environmental remediation, metal recovery, and chemical processing.


Product Application of Sodium dithionite CAS#7775-14-6

Sodium dithionite (sodium hydrosulfite) functions as a reducing agent, sulfonating agent, chelating agent and decolorizing agent in aqueous systems and organic reactions. It is widely utilized in water treatment, gas purification, cleaning formulations, leather processing, polymer manufacturing and photography. In chemical enhanced oil recovery, it stabilizes polyacrylamide polymers to prevent radical degradation induced by iron ions. It also serves a key role in soil chemistry for iron content determination.
